Gathering a legacy in music refers to the lasting impact and contributions made by an individual or group within the music industry, leaving a significant mark on its history and culture. It encompasses the creation of influential music, breaking new ground, inspiring future generations, and achieving widespread recognition for their talent and artistry.

Building a musical legacy involves various factors, including producing timeless and impactful music that resonates with audiences, pushing the boundaries of musical genres, collaborating with other talented musicians, and receiving critical acclaim and awards. Additionally, it often entails mentoring and supporting emerging artists, contributing to the preservation and growth of the music industry.

Throughout history, numerous individuals and groups have gathered significant legacies in music, shaping its evolution and leaving an indelible mark on popular culture. From classical composers like Mozart and Beethoven to legendary rock bands like the Beatles and Led Zeppelin, these artists have created music that continues to inspire, influence, and captivate audiences worldwide. Their legacies extend beyond their musical creations, as they often represent cultural movements, societal changes, and the spirit of their time.

Timeless Creations

In the realm of music, creating timeless creations is paramount to gathering a lasting legacy. Timeless music transcends the boundaries of time, appealing to audiences across generations and leaving an enduring impact on the industry and culture. It possesses universal qualities that resonate with human emotions, experiences, and aspirations, ensuring its relevance and significance over the years.

The ability to craft timeless creations stems from a deep understanding of musical principles, an intuitive grasp of melody and harmony, and the capacity to convey emotions and messages through music. Timeless music often embodies a combination of originality, authenticity, and emotional depth, allowing it to connect with listeners on a profound level. It transcends fads and trends, becoming part of the collective musical heritage and inspiring generations of musicians and music lovers alike.

Numerous examples of timeless creations can be found throughout the history of music. From classical masterpieces like Beethoven's Symphony No. 5 to iconic rock songs like "Imagine" by John Lennon, these compositions have stood the test of time, continuing to captivate and move audiences decades after their creation. They have become ingrained in our cultural fabric, serving as touchstones for human experiences and emotions.

Creating timeless creations is not merely a technical endeavor; it requires an artist's unique vision, passion, and dedication to their craft. It involves tapping into the human condition, expressing universal truths, and crafting music that resonates with the deepest parts of our being. By doing so, musicians can leave a lasting legacy that transcends their own lifetime and continues to inspire and enrich the lives of others.

Enduring Influence

Enduring influence is a crucial component of gathering a legacy in music, as it represents the ability of an artist's work to transcend time and continue to inspire and influence future generations. This influence can manifest in various forms, such as shaping musical genres, inspiring new artists, and contributing to the development of music education and appreciation.

Throughout history, numerous musicians have left an enduring legacy through their groundbreaking contributions. Beethoven's symphonies continue to be performed and studied by musicians worldwide, while Bob Dylan's songwriting has influenced generations of folk and rock artists. Their music has not only entertained audiences but also served as a source of inspiration, shaping the trajectory of music and inspiring countless individuals to pursue their own musical journeys.
